Abstrait
  • The project report details the development, implementation and evaluation of a program of ministry for a part-time chaplain in a proprietary nursing home setting. The specific concern of the program is the emphasis placed on the spiritual well-being of the residents. The project begins with an overview of the program and the development of a theology of aging. Problems and attitudes associated with aging and older persons are also stressed. In addition, institutionalized care is discussed and the development of a ministry to and with the residents and staff is explored. Various forms for implementation and evaluation are found in the appendix.
